How do you remember renal physiology?
Use the mnemonic, A WET BED: A) maintenance of ACID-base balance; W) maintenance of WATER balance; E) balance of ELECTROLYTES; T) removal of TOXINS; B) control of BLOOD pressure; E) production of ERYTHROPOIETIN; and D) metabolism of vitamin D.
